Two-time Olympic champion at the 2006 Torino Games ... Younger brother
of Manuela, one of the most decorated cross-country skiers in Olympic
history ... True to the spirit of his sport, spent entire days in the
woods as a teenager, working as a woodsman by day and training by night
to become an Olympian ... Annnounced as Italian flag bearer at the Opening Ceremony.
